Digital Farming Market Transformation and Comprehensive Digital Farming Analysis

Modern agriculture is experiencing a significant transformation as technology reshapes farming practices. Digital farming enables real-time monitoring, predictive analytics, and automation, allowing farmers to optimize resources, improve efficiency, and maintain sustainable operations. This transformation is crucial for addressing food security challenges and environmental concerns.

Digital farming technologies include drones, IoT sensors, cloud-based platforms, and AI-powered analytics. These tools provide insights into soil quality, crop growth, and environmental conditions. Farmers can adjust irrigation, fertilization, and pest management strategies in response to real-time data, minimizing waste and improving yields. Digital solutions also support sustainable practices by reducing chemical usage and optimizing resource consumption.

Several factors are driving digital farming adoption. Climate variability, population growth, and the need for efficient land use create strong incentives for technology integration. Advances in AI, IoT, and cloud computing have made digital tools more accessible and cost-effective, enabling farms of all sizes to benefit. These technologies help reduce operational costs, improve productivity, and support sustainable agricultural practices.

Government policies, research collaborations, and technical support programs further facilitate adoption. Subsidies, grants, and training programs help farmers integrate digital solutions into their operations. Collaboration between technology developers and research institutions ensures solutions are adaptable to diverse climates, soil types, and crop varieties, accelerating innovation and practical implementation.

Challenges remain in digital adoption, including high initial investment, technical skill gaps, and rural connectivity issues. Data privacy and security are also important as farms increasingly rely on cloud-based monitoring systems. Addressing these challenges through education, infrastructure development, and secure technology platforms is essential for maximizing the benefits of digital farming.

Future developments in digital farming may include autonomous machinery, predictive crop analytics, and fully integrated digital platforms. AI-powered systems can forecast disease outbreaks, optimize resource allocation, and automate routine tasks. These innovations will create more efficient, sustainable, and profitable farming operations.
